External plugin authors submitting integrations for the HarrowField gateway must pass three stages: automated schema validation, a sandboxed replay against recorded tractor telemetry, and a manual compatibility review. Plugins touching the CAN-bus decoding layer require an additional safety review, as malformed frames can stall the whole ingest pipeline. Reviews run weekly; expect a decision within ten business days. Resubmissions after rejection must include a changelog of fixes. Final approval authority for all external plugins rests with:

signatory, bajof-yahif: Zorael Wenael

## CI note: checkout load-test flakiness

Welcome to the Pondermint team. If the checkout load-test stage fails intermittently, don't re-run it blindly. The Swiftlane harness spins up 200 synthetic carts, and failures usually mean the payment stub pool was exhausted, not that checkout regressed. Check the harness log for pool-starvation warnings first; if present, bump the pool size in the stage config and rerun once. When filing a flake report, always attach the trace token printed below.

pipeline stamp: htk9_6ce9d33c5

# Artifact Signing — Lodenreef Profile Shard Rollout

All shard-migration bundles for the user-profile store must be signed before upload. One bundle per shard; no batching. Use the `reefsign` tool, not the legacy wrapper. Verify the manifest hash matches the shard map committed in the migration repo. If verification fails, stop — do not resign. Signing for the contractor sandbox environment uses the key listed below.

release key, yagap-kagag: bky6_1ks93y